Use-after-free in Blink in Google Chrome

IdentifiersCVE-2026-4449CWE-416· Use After Free

CVE-2026-4449 is a high-severity use-after-free vulnerability in Blink, the rendering engine used by Google Chrome. According to the provided content, affected Chrome versions prior to 146.0.7680.153 contain a memory lifetime management flaw in Blink that can be triggered by a remote attacker via a crafted HTML page. A successful trigger can lead to heap corruption. As described in the supporting material, this issue is part of a broader Chrome security update addressing memory corruption flaws that may be exploitable when a victim is lured to attacker-controlled web content.

Impact

What an attacker gets, and what they’ve been doing with it.

Successful exploitation may allow a remote, unauthenticated attacker to corrupt heap memory in the browser process by convincing a user to visit a maliciously crafted webpage. In the Chrome threat model, Blink memory corruption vulnerabilities can potentially result in browser process compromise, including arbitrary code execution, denial of service through renderer crashes, or possibly information disclosure, depending on exploit reliability and the surrounding sandbox and platform defenses. The provided content specifically states that the vulnerability could potentially be exploited via heap corruption.

Remediation

Patch, then assume compromise.

Upgrade Google Chrome or Chromium-based packages to a fixed version. The provided content states that Google fixed this issue in Chrome 146.0.7680.153 and later, with Windows and macOS also receiving 146.0.7680.154 builds in the same release train. Systems running versions prior to 146.0.7680.153 should be updated immediately. For downstream Chromium packages, apply the vendor-supplied security updates that incorporate the upstream fix set for CVE-2026-4449.
